Other neighbourhoods around Norwood Park

O'Hare
Consider a visit to Fashion Outlets of Chicago and take some time to enjoy the abundant dining options during your time in O'Hare. If you want to see more of the city, jump on the metro at Cumberland Station or Remote Parking Station.

Wrigleyville
You might enjoy the bars while in Wrigleyville. Wrigley Field is a notable sight, and you can get around town at Sheridan Station or Addison Station (Red Line) to see more of the city.

Lakeview
Known for its great bars and fantastic lake views, there's plenty to explore in Lakeview. You can visit top attractions like Wrigley Field and Lake Michigan, and jump on the metro at Southport Station or Addison Station (Red Line) to see more of the city.

Wicker Park
Consider exploring the abundant dining options in Wicker Park. If sightseeing is on the list, Milwaukee Avenue is a top attraction. Hop on the metro at Damen Station or Division Station to see more of the area.

West Town
Noted for its live music and theaters, there's plenty to explore in West Town. Top attractions like The Salt Shed and Milwaukee Avenue are major draws, and you can hop on the metro at Division Station or Damen Station to see more of the city.

Lincoln Park
Known for its ample dining options and fantastic lake views, there's plenty to explore in Lincoln Park. You can visit top attractions like Lake Michigan and Lincoln Hall, and jump on the metro at Fullerton Station or Armitage Station to see more of the city.
